金属氧化物沉积法制备钛酸铋钠陶瓷的研究

摘    要:金属氧化物沉积法(MOD)成功地制备了Bi1/22Na1/2TiO3(NBT)基无铅压电陶瓷,样品的X射线衍射(XRD)结果显示其具有较好的结晶性,XRD指标化后的结果表明,晶胞参数的变化,在室温下是赝立方相。通过测量不同退火条件下陶瓷表观密度,得到NBT陶瓷采用MOD法的最大密度可在烧结温度约为1150℃左右。

关 键 词:钛酸铋钠  MOD  XRD
